World No. 1 Aryna Sabalenka prepares to face No. 6 seed Jasmine Paolini in a highly anticipated 2025 Miami Open semifinal clash. This match not only pits two in-form players against each other but also adds another chapter to their growing rivalry, while Sabalenka chases both her first Miami final and a place in history books. Key Insights

Sabalenka holds a narrow 3-2 lead in their overall head-to-head meetings (3-1 in WTA Tour matches), winning their most recent encounter at the 2024 WTA Finals in Riyadh.

Paolini secured her wins at the Ilkley ITF event in 2017 and Indian Wells in 2022.

By reaching the Miami semis, Sabalenka joins Steffi Graf, Martina Hingis, and Serena Williams as the only World No. 1s to reach the semifinals of the Australian Open, Indian Wells, and Miami Open in the first three months of a season.

Paolini has made history as the first Italian woman to reach the semifinals of the Miami Open.

In-Depth Analysis

The rivalry between Aryna Sabalenka and Jasmine Paolini has seen five previous encounters, with Sabalenka edging Paolini 3-2. While Sabalenka won their WTA-level matches in Linz (2020), Beijing (2023), and Riyadh (2024), Paolini proved she could challenge the top player with wins in Ilkley (2017) and notably at Indian Wells (2022).

Sabalenka enters this semifinal on a mission. Despite reaching the final at the Australian Open and Indian Wells earlier in 2025 (falling just short in both, according to reports cited), she has looked dominant in Miami, reaching the semis without dropping a set. Her powerful game, built around a formidable serve and groundstrokes, makes her the favorite (-625 betting odds). Standing at 5'10", she also possesses a significant height advantage over the 5'3" Paolini.

However, Paolini shouldn't be underestimated. After a relatively slow start to 2025, she has found top form in Miami, notably defeating Naomi Osaka. Her speed, dynamic style, and improved backhand make her a tricky opponent who could potentially frustrate Sabalenka, especially if she gains crowd support. Paolini's run marks a historic moment for Italian tennis.

Sabalenka aims for her first-ever Miami Open final, seeking to convert her consistent deep runs into another major title. Paolini looks to continue her giant-killing run and reach a maiden Miami final.
